    In England yesterday I saw a bus X178CHJ. An Alexander ALX400 body. I noticed it had CIE typeface on its emergency exit, prompting me to think it is a former Dublin bus. I should have taken a better look to see which other features it retained.

    Formerly AV15 of Ringsend, now with Red Route of Northfleet.

    ex-DB vehicles are very popular with UK operators, and command good resale value.
